The first decade of the 21st century was a tumultuous period for the global economy, characterized by significant booms and busts and substantial shifts in **interest rate** policies. Initially, in the early 2000s, the Federal Reserve responded to the bursting of the dot-com bubble by lowering interest rates to stimulate economic activity. The goal was to encourage borrowing and investment to counteract the slowdown caused by the collapse of technology stocks. These low interest rates, however, contributed to the rise of another asset bubble, this time in the housing market. As interest rates remained low, mortgage lending increased, and housing prices soared. This period saw the proliferation of subprime mortgages and other risky lending practices, which ultimately set the stage for the financial crisis of 2008. The financial crisis of 2008 had a profound impact on interest rates. As the crisis unfolded, central banks around the world, including the Federal Reserve, slashed interest rates to near-zero levels in an attempt to stabilize financial markets and prevent a complete economic collapse. This marked the beginning of an era of unprecedented monetary policy easing. In addition to lowering interest rates, central banks also implemented unconventional measures such as quantitative easing (QE), which involved purchasing government bonds and other assets to inject liquidity into the financial system. The aim was to lower long-term interest rates and stimulate economic activity. The period following the financial crisis was characterized by slow economic recovery and persistently low inflation. As a result, interest rates remained at historically low levels for an extended period. This created challenges for savers and investors, who struggled to generate returns in a low-yield environment. Overall, the decade from 2001 to 2010 was a period of significant economic and financial upheaval, with interest rates playing a central role in both the boom and the bust. The lessons learned from this period continue to shape monetary policy and regulatory practices today.
